Here is a recipe for Marmalade Crush Oyster Mignonette:

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up orange marmalade
  • 1/4 cup finely minced shallots or red onion
  • 2 tablespoons white wine vinegar or champagne v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Optional: 1 tablespoon orange liqueur or 1 teaspoon grated orange zest

Instructions:

1. In a small saucepan, heat the marmalade over medium heat until it is melted and smooth.

2. Add the minced shallots or onion to the saucepan and cook until they are softened and fragrant, about 2-3 minutes.

3. Stir in the vinegar, sugar, and black pepper, and adjust the seasoning to taste. If using orange liqueur or zest, add it in at this point as well.

4. Remove the sauce from the heat and let it cool to room temperature.

5. To serve, spoon a small amount of the Marmalade Crush mignonette sauce over each oyster before eating.
